我正在使用UITableView来显示一组持久保存在服务器上的对象。服务器在检测到更改时通知客户端拉出新集。我不喜欢重新加载整个表。我需要一种算法来使用插入、移动、重新加载和删除操作来修补旧表,以便将其转换为新表。完成此任务的最简单算法是什么? 最佳答案 我应该先用谷歌搜索一下,对于那些最终来到这里寻求答案的人;https://github.com/khanlou/NSArray-LongestCommonSubsequence 关于ios-UITableView的表差异补丁算法,我们在
概述:在C和C++中,intfun()和intfun(void)的区别在于函数参数的声明方式。前者默认允许任意参数,而后者明确表示没有参数。通过清晰的实例源代码,详细解释了它们在函数声明和调用中的不同之处。在C和C++中,intfun()和intfun(void)的区别在于函数的参数声明方式。以下是对它们的详细描述,包括方法、步骤和相应的示例源代码。intfun()和intfun(void)的区别:1.intfun():方法: 函数未指定参数时,编译器默认允许传递任意个数和类型的参数。步骤: 函数声明时未明确指定参数,但允许调用时传递任意参数。#includeintfun(){std::co
概述:在C和C++中,intfun()和intfun(void)的区别在于函数参数的声明方式。前者默认允许任意参数,而后者明确表示没有参数。通过清晰的实例源代码,详细解释了它们在函数声明和调用中的不同之处。在C和C++中,intfun()和intfun(void)的区别在于函数的参数声明方式。以下是对它们的详细描述,包括方法、步骤和相应的示例源代码。intfun()和intfun(void)的区别:1.intfun():方法: 函数未指定参数时,编译器默认允许传递任意个数和类型的参数。步骤: 函数声明时未明确指定参数,但允许调用时传递任意参数。#includeintfun(){std::co
有人可以向我解释激活和复发性激活参数之间在初始化KerasLSTM层中传递的差异吗?根据我的理解,LSTM有4层。如果我不将任何激活参数传递给LSTM构造函数,请说明每一层的默认激活功能是什么?看答案上代码1932年的线i=self.recurrent_activation(z0)f=self.recurrent_activation(z1)c=f*c_tm1+i*self.activation(z2)o=self.recurrent_activation(z3)h=o*self.activation(c)recurrent_activation用于激活输入/忘记/输出门。激活如果用于细胞状态
我有这个代码CGFloatdashArray[]={5,2};CGContextSetLineDash(context,3,dashArray,4);CGMutablePathRefpath=[selfnewArcPathAtPoint:pointwithRadius:radiusstartAngle:startAngleendAngle:endAngle];[colorsetStroke];CGContextAddPath(context,path);CGContextStrokePath(context);CGPathRelease(path);它在“调试”时给我这个:这是关于“发
SQLServer还原完整备份和差异备份的操作过程介绍1.首先右键数据库,点击还原数据库:重点:名词解释:介绍这篇文章主要介绍了SQLServer还原完整备份和差异备份的详细操作,本文通过图文并茂的形式给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下1.首先右键数据库,点击还原数据库:1、还原完整数据库,选择好完整数据库的备份文件,在【选项】中,【还原选项】选择覆盖现有数据库,【恢复状态】选择第二个,点击确定。然后会打开还原数据库窗口,如图所示:首先“源”选择设备,并且选择到完整备份的数据库备份文件然后在“目标”数据库可直接填写还原以后的数据库名称接着点击左
我正在尝试在C++中实现一个简单的LinkedList插入。现在,我的代码看起来像是第一次尝试,代码本身是不言自明的,但是我添加了一些明显的评论,因为Stackoverflow不允许我在不提出一些评论的情况下发布问题://Simpleclassandstructnodestructnode{intdata;structnode*next;};classlist{//Memberfunctionsprivate://Definingstructobjectnode*root;public:boolinsertNode(node*root);//Insertionfunctionvoidprint
BingTranslator声称使用MSTranslator。但是,MSTransalator提供的翻译与Bing提供的翻译之间可能存在严重的差异。在大多数情况下,Bing翻译看起来更好。有人可以告诉我是否有一些特定的参数值或选项应在MS-Translator中设置,以使翻译与Bing相等(或更近)?是否有任何特殊订阅(如果需要)可以在MS-Translator中获得更好的质量翻译?(我的意思是:更接近Bing)我们目前对MS-Translator有付费订阅,我们正在使用MstranslatorAPI的“翻译”功能。...https://api.microsofttranslator.com/
我有下面的表格,其中包含两列hive>select*fromhivetable;a2016-09-16T03:01:12.367782Zb2016-09-16T03:01:12.300514Zc2016-09-16T03:01:12.241532Za2016-09-16T03:01:12.138016Zc2016-09-16T03:01:12.136986Zb2016-09-16T03:01:10.512201Zc2016-09-16T03:01:12.235671ZTimetaken:0.457seconds,Fetched:7row(s)现在我想从第一列中找到唯一值和时间戳差异,或
我试图找出连续行中两个日期之间的差异。我在配置单元中使用窗口函数,即lag。但不同之处在于,输出格式应为hh:mm:ss。例如:日期1是2017-08-1502:00:32日期2是2017-08-1502:00:20输出应该是:00:00:12我试过的查询:selectfrom_unixtime(column_name),(lag(unix_timestamp(from_unixtime(column_name)),1,0)over(partitionbycolumn_name)-unix_timestamp(from_unixtime(column_name)))asDuration